Discover the Best BookLikes Alternative for Your Reading Life

BookLikes has long been a beloved platform for book enthusiasts, offering a free and independent space to publish book reviews, organize virtual bookshelves, and connect with fellow readers worldwide. Its features, including a personal webpage, blog, and reading timeline, have made it a go-to for many. However, as the digital landscape evolves, readers often seek new features, different communities, or a fresh interface. If you're looking for a new hub for your reading journey, exploring a BookLikes alternative could be your next great read.

Goodreads

Goodreads

Goodreads is arguably the most popular BookLikes alternative, offering a comprehensive platform for tracking your reading, organizing books into virtual bookshelves, and connecting with friends. Available on Web, Android, iPhone, Android Tablet, and iPad, Goodreads boasts features like reading progress tracking, Amazon integration, a book manager, and a vibrant social feed with user ratings, making it a powerful choice for social readers.

LibraryThing

LibraryThing

LibraryThing provides an excellent BookLikes alternative for those focused on cataloging their entire library. This freemium web-based platform excels at easy, library-quality cataloging, allowing users to input what they're reading or their whole collection. Its features include a robust library management system, a reading list, and a social network for connecting with other book lovers.

inventaire.io

inventaire.io

For a unique and community-driven BookLikes alternative, consider inventaire.io. This free, open-source web platform allows users to keep an inventory of their books, share them with others, and discover books available within their network. Its focus on sharing and its multi-language support make it a fantastic open-source option for collaborative reading communities.
